Harnessing Public Food Procurement as a Tool for Diet Related Non-Communicable Disease Prevention in Public Health Facilities in South Africa

As diet-related non-communicable diseases (NCDs) continue to rise in South Africa, there is an urgent need for interventions that not only discourage the consumption of unhealthy foods but also foster healthier food environments. This paper explores the potential of public food procurement (PFP) as a strategic tool for NCD prevention Continue Reading
